Sears resolves rule violation in gift program
Sears resolves rule violation in gift program
By Karen Jowers - Staff writer
Posted : Friday Oct 24, 2008 10:11:21 EDT

The more than 10,000 military families who registered for the Sears “Heroes at Home Wish Registry” will be able to get their gift cards without violating Defense Department ethics violations, under an agreement reached late Thursday between Sears and defense officials.

Sears has also extended the registration period to Oct. 31, and will allow up to 20,000 service members to register, said Sears spokesman Tom Aiello.

The company has made adjustments in the program, such as expanding it to all active-duty members, including activated Guard and Reserve members. All ranks are now eligible, expanding it from the previous limitation to E-6 and below. Sears will validate the status of the service members with the Defense Department’s help.

Before the changes, the Defense Department warned Sears that the program violated ethics laws and asked it to stop registering service members.

“After reviewing the available details of the Wish Registry, we determined that, as structured, participation in the Wish Registry results in an improper solicitation,” Leigh Bradley, director of the Standards of Conduct Office for the Defense Department General Counsel, had written in an Oct. 14 letter to Sears.
